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
233886993 96116464 187435 30703878 7250271234
835289333 13003292 42394
835289333 13003292 42394
241585 04 69424375
All about undefined
Interested in learning more?
835289333 13003292 42394
241585 04 69424375
See more
0079662990 502
32056368 3835504 016981 962350
See more
59660 16628871999
181266726 40 30
See more